ГлавнаяБлогКарты Warcraft 3Гайды для первой ДотыГайды для Доты 2 [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 2 из 4
  • «
  • 1
  • 2
  • 3
  • 4
  • »
{ Нововведение I } - { Новая форма добавления ответа }
Ваш выбор:
1. Да [ 8 ] [50.00%]
2. Нет [ 7 ] [43.75%]
3. Присоединяюсь к большинству [ 1 ] [6.25%]
Всего ответов: 16
Дата: Среда, 22.07.2009, 22:13 | Сообщение # 1
> /dev/null
Проверенные
Сообщений: 1281
Награды: 10
Голосуем, стоит ли вводить на сайте такую форму добавления ответа:

Примерно так выглядеть будет, но на самом деле цветовой стиль формы будет как сейчас, т.к. никаких собственных стилей код не содержит.
ВНИМАНИЕ, ПРЕЖДЕ ЧЕМ ВЫ ОТДАДИТЕ СВОЙ ГОЛОС, ПРОЧИТАЙТЕ ПРИМЕЧАНИЕ К КАРТИНКЕ!!!


Точнее все будет сверху, никаких пробелов и пустых пространств, что на счет цветовой гаммы: код автонастроечный, маскируется под дизайн.
Кнопки будут прежними
Сам код формы:
Зеленым выделен бонус: отправка сообщения на ctrl+enter
Quote

<div>
<!--Отправка на ctrl+enter-->
<script type="text/javascript">
function ctrl_enter(e, form)
{
if (((e.keyCode == 13) || (e.keyCode == 10)) && (e.ctrlKey == true)) document.all.addform.submit()
}
</script>
<!--/Отправка на ctrl+enter-->


<style type="text/css">
fieldset {border: 1px solid green}
</style>

<!--translit-->
<script type="text/javascript" src="http://kara-kula.ucoz.ru/JS/Translit/alltranslit.js"></script>
<!--/translit-->

<?if($ERROR$)?>
<table>
<tr id="frM1">
<td colspan="2" align="center" class="gTableError" id="frM2">$ERROR$</td>
</tr>
</table>
<?endif?>

<?if($_USER$)?>
<table>
<tr id="frM3">
<td class="gTableLeft" id="frM4">Имя:</td>
<td class="gTableRight" id="frM5">$_USER$</td>
</tr>
</table>
<?endif?>

<fieldset>
<legend><?if($_THREAD_NAME$)?>$_THREAD_NAME$<hr>$_THREAD_DESCR$<?else?>$FORM_TITLE$<?endif?> </legend>

<?if($_POLL_QUESTION$)?>

<fieldset>
<legend>$_POLL_QUESTION$</legend>
$_POLL_ANSWERS$
</fieldset>
<fieldset>
<legend>Опции опроса:</legend>
$_POLL_ONLY_OPT$<label for="pollonly">Только опрос (писать ответы в теме будет нельзя)</label>
<br />
$_POLL_MULTI_OPT$<label for="pollmulty">Включить возможность выбора нескольких вариантов ответов</label>
<br />
$_POLL_PERIOD_OPT$ Период голосования (0 - без ограничений)
</fieldset>
<?endif?>

<?if($BBCODES$)?><div style="padding-left: 10px">$BBCODES$</div><?endif?>
<table>
<tr>
<td width="100%" valign="top" id="frM58">

<span OnKeyPress="return ctrl_enter(event, this.form);">
$_MESSAGE$
</span>

<input style="width:110px;" id="frF15" class="postPreview" type="button" value="Просмотреть" onclick="prepost();" />
<input type="submit" id="frF16" name="sbm" style="width:150px;font-weight:bold;" class="postSubmit" value="$SUBMIT_SIGN$" />
<input style="width:110px;" id="frF17" class="postReset" type="reset" value="Отменить" /></div>
</td>

<td valign="top" style="padding-top: 5px">
<fieldset>
<legend>Опции сообщения:</legend>
<?if($_HTML_OPT$)?>
$_HTML_OPT$ <label for="ahtml">Включить HTML теги</label><br />
$_MAKE_BR_OPT$ <label for="frmt">тегом <b><BR></b></label><br>
<?endif?>
<?if($_EDITED_OPT$)?>
$_EDITED_OPT$ <label for="edited">Надпись "Отредактировано"</label><br />
<?endif?>
<?if($_SMILES_OPT$)?>
$_SMILES_OPT$ <label for="smon">Включить смайлы</label><br />
<?endif?>
<?if($_SIGNATURE_OPT$)?>
$_SIGNATURE_OPT$ <label for="sgon">Включить подпись</label><br />
<?endif?>
<?if($_SUBSCRIBE_OPT$)?>
$_SUBSCRIBE_OPT$ <label for="sbon">Уведомления на e-mail при ответах</label><br />
<?endif?>
</fieldset>

<?if($_FILES_UPLOADER$)?>
<fieldset>
<legend>Файлы:(не более <b>$FILE_MAX_SIZE$</b>Kb)</legend>
$_FILES_UPLOADER$
</fieldset>
<?endif?>

<?if($MODER_OPTIONS_FLAG$)?>
<fieldset>
<legend>Опции Темы</legend>
<?if($_FIRSTONTOP_OPT$)?>
$_FIRSTONTOP_OPT$ <label for="firstontop">Первое сообщение ― щапка</label><br />
<?endif?>
<?if($_ONTOP_OPT$)?>
$_ONTOP_OPT$ <label for="isontop">Тема всегда сверху</label><br />
<?endif?>
<?if($_CLOSED_OPT$)?>
$_CLOSED_OPT$ <label for="isclosed">Закрытая тема</label><br />
<?endif?>
</fieldset>
<?endif?>

<fieldset cellpadding="2" class="smiles" onmouseover="document.getElementById('allSmiles').style.display='';" onmouseout="document.getElementById('allSmiles').style.display='none';">
<legend>Смайлы</legend>
<script type="text/javascript">
function emoticon(code,nm)
{
if (code != "")
{
var txtarea=document.getElementById(nm);code = ' ' + code + ' ';
if (document.selection)
{
txtarea.focus();var txtContent = txtarea.value;
var str = document.selection.createRange();
if (str.text == "") {str.text = code;}
else if (txtContent.indexOf(str.text) != -1){str.text = code + str.text;}
else {txtarea.value = txtContent + code;}
}
else {txtarea.value = txtarea.value + code;}
}
}
</script>

<table border="0">
<tr><td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on('>(','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/angry.gif" title="angry"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(':D','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/biggrin.gif" title="biggrin"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on('B)','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/cool.gif" title="cool"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(':\'(','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/cry.gif" title="cry"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on('<_<','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/dry.gif" title="dry"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on('^_^','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/happy.gif" title="happy"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(':(','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/sad.gif" title="sad"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(':)','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/smile.gif" title="smile" /></a></td>
<tr/><tr><td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(':o','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/surprised.gif" title="surprised"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(':p','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/tongue.gif" title="tongue"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on('%)','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/wacko.gif" title="wacko" /></a></td>
<td class="sml1" align="center"><a href="javascript://" rel="nofollow" onclick="emoticon(';)','message');return false;">
<img style="margin:0;padding:0;border:0;" src="http://s36.ucoz.net/sm/1/wink.gif" title="wink" /></a></td>
<td colspan="4" align="center" id="allSmiles" style="display:none;" nowrap align="center"><a href="javascript://" rel="nofollow" onclick="new _uWnd('Sml',' ',-250,-350,{autosize:0,closeonesc:1,resize:0},{url:'/index/35-1-0'});return false;">Все смайлы</a></td>
<tr/>
</table></fieldset>

</td></tr>
</table>

</fieldset>

</div>



инструкция по пробной установке приложена файлом. Прошу учесть, что замена будет происходить на уровне сервера, а не у клиента!
Прикрепления: Kakstavit.txt (0.7 Kb)
 
Дата: Четверг, 23.07.2009, 11:04 | Сообщение # 11
Генералиссимус
Проверенные
Сообщений: 1824
Награды: 8
Репутация: 47
За, удобно на картинке выглядит
 
Дата: Четверг, 23.07.2009, 15:42 | Сообщение # 12
Стратег
Проверенные
Сообщений: 2838
Награды: 6
Репутация: 47
я поголосовал нетибо привык к старому но выглядит стильно

(.́_.̀ ) Окей
 
Дата: Пятница, 24.07.2009, 19:06 | Сообщение # 13
Генералиссимус
Модераторы
Сообщений: 12998
Награды: 22
Репутация: 141
Если честно не знаю, всё вроде компактно... вот только как это будет смотреться на деле... вы поставьте, а там посмотрим, восстановить по умолчанию дело одного нажатия клавиши мышки =)))

это Ксопик!
 
Дата: Пятница, 24.07.2009, 20:35 | Сообщение # 14
Admin
Администраторы
Сообщений: 15097
Награды: 43
Репутация: 188
с транслитом вроде проблем у нас на форуме пока нет. Кроме дизайна есть ли еще какие нибудь улучшения по сравнению со стандартной формой добавления ответа? И будет ли действовать стандартная настройка прав для всех категорий пользователей? Например только проверенным и выше можно добавлять ББ-коды в ответах, иначе спамом завалят с активными ссылками, так было до обновления юкоза, а на скриншоте я вижу значок для добавления ссылки и для обычных юзеров

Warcraft 3 - это уже легенда
WC3 - это мини-легенда
Дота - это альтернативный путь развития варкрафта
 
Дата: Пятница, 24.07.2009, 20:40 | Сообщение # 15
> /dev/null
Проверенные
Сообщений: 1281
Награды: 10
Admin, с этим всё хорошо.
 
Дата: Суббота, 25.07.2009, 23:22 | Сообщение # 16
> /dev/null
Проверенные
Сообщений: 1281
Награды: 10
Блин, не флудим!
 
Дата: Понедельник, 27.07.2009, 20:23 | Сообщение # 17
Admin
Администраторы
Сообщений: 15097
Награды: 43
Репутация: 188
ну здесь тоже 4 за и 4 против
пока тоже ощутимого перевеса нет
ждем


Warcraft 3 - это уже легенда
WC3 - это мини-легенда
Дота - это альтернативный путь развития варкрафта
 
Дата: Понедельник, 27.07.2009, 23:24 | Сообщение # 18
Удаленные





Mihahail, ну я незнаю откуда этот михаэльвзялся7
ты кто Друг админа? или Ливы?
я против тк это уже рассматривали
ЧИТАЙ ФОРУМ внимательнее
 
Дата: Вторник, 28.07.2009, 11:40 | Сообщение # 19
> /dev/null
Проверенные
Сообщений: 1281
Награды: 10
FATER, с луны свалился. Да, я друг Админа и Ливы, причем довольно продолжительно время)
ты меня в форум не тыкай, это моя обязанность за ним следить. Тагда не было явного желания ставить или нет, а сейчас голосованием всё решится.


Дарагие форумчане, напоминаю:
Голосуйте пожалуйста исходя из соображений о красоте и изяществе, а так же о удобсвте и новизне. ваш выбор действительно субъективен, но субъективность эту следует напрявлять на сам продукт, а не на автора.
 
Дата: Вторник, 28.07.2009, 12:06 | Сообщение # 20
Удаленные





Quote (Mihahail)
с луны свалился

хаха
ну раз так
предлагай
я не против! smile
 
  • Страница 2 из 4
  • «
  • 1
  • 2
  • 3
  • 4
  • »
Поиск: